The digital age has ushered in an era of unprecedented change, fundamentally altering how we communicate, conduct business, and, most importantly, manage our finances. Amidst this revolution, a powerful new paradigm has emerged: blockchain technology. Far from being just the underpinning of c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in, blockchain represents a fundamental shift in how trust, security, and value are established and exchanged. At its core, blockchain is a decentralized, distributed ledger that records transactions across many computers. This distributed nature makes it incredibly resistant to modification, fraud, and censorship. Each block in the chain contains a number of transactions, and once a block is added to the chain, it cannot be altered. This immutability, coupled with cryptographic principles, ensures the integrity and security of the data.

Imagine a digital ledger, but instead of being held in one central location, it's shared and synchronized across thousands, even millions, of computers worldwide. This makes it virtually impossible for any single entity to tamper with the records. This inherent transparency and security are the bedrock upon which the "Blockchain Profit System" is built. One of the most significant aspects of the Blockchain Profit System is its ability to democratize finance. Traditional financial systems often involve intermediaries like banks, brokers, and payment processors, which can add layers of complexity, fees, and delays. Blockchain, by contrast, facilitates peer-to-peer transactions, cutting out these middlemen and empowering individuals to have more direct control over their assets. This disintermediation is a core tenet of the Blockchain Profit System, leading to lower transaction costs and faster settlement times.

Within this system, various avenues for profit emerge. Cryptocurrency trading is perhaps the most well-known, where individuals buy and sell digital assets based on market fluctuations. However, the Blockchain Profit System extends far beyond simple trading. Decentralized Finance, or DeFi, is a rapidly evolving ecosystem built on blockchain technology that aims to recreate traditional financial services like lending, borrowing, and insurance in a decentralized manner. Platforms within DeFi allow users to earn interest on their crypto holdings, lend their assets to others for a fee, or even take out loans without needing to go through a bank. This opens up a world of passive income opportunities, where your digital assets can actively work for you.

Smart contracts play a pivotal role in enabling these advanced functionalities. These are self-executing contracts with the terms of the agreement directly written into code. They automatically execute when predetermined conditions are met, eliminating the need for enforcement by a central authority. For instance, a smart contract could be programmed to automatically release funds from an escrow account once a certain deliverable is confirmed on the blockchain. In the context of the Blockchain Profit System, smart contracts can automate dividend payouts, manage investment portfolios, and facilitate secure, transparent crowdfunding campaigns.

The security offered by blockchain technology is another critical component. Cryptography is used to secure all transactions and to control the creation of new units of cryptocurrencies. The distributed nature of the ledger means that even if one node (computer) in the network is compromised, the entire system remains secure. This robust security framework instills confidence in users, encouraging greater participation in the blockchain economy and, consequently, in the Blockchain Profit System.

Furthermore, the transparency inherent in blockchain is a game-changer. While individual identities can be pseudonymous, the transactions themselves are publicly verifiable on the ledger. This means anyone can audit the flow of assets, fostering a level of accountability and trust that is often lacking in traditional finance. This transparency is crucial for building confidence in new financial products and services.

The Blockchain Profit System also encompasses the burgeoning world of Non-Fungible Tokens (NFTs). While often associated with digital art, NFTs are unique digital assets that represent ownership of a specific item, whether it's a piece of art, a collectible, a virtual land parcel, or even a concert ticket. The creation and trading of NFTs occur on blockchains, opening up new markets for creators and collectors and presenting opportunities for profit through asset appreciation and royalties.

One of the most accessible entry points into the Blockchain Profit System is through cryptocurrency investments. This involves acquiring digital assets with the expectation that their value will increase over time. However, this is not merely about speculation. A nuanced approach involves understanding market trends, the underlying technology and utility of different cryptocurrencies, and adopting strategies such as dollar-cost averaging to mitigate volatility. Diversification across various digital assets is also paramount, much like in traditional investing, to spread risk. The Blockchain Profit System encourages a more informed approach, moving beyond the hype to focus on projects with strong fundamentals, active development teams, and clear use cases.

Decentralized Finance (DeFi) represents a more advanced frontier within the Blockchain Profit System, offering significant potential for passive income. Platforms built on blockchains like Ethereum, Binance Smart Chain, and Solana allow users to engage in activities such as staking, yield farming, and liquidity provision. Staking involves locking up your cryptocurrency holdings to support the operation of a blockchain network, earning rewards in return. Yield farming, while more complex and carrying higher risk, involves strategically moving crypto assets between different DeFi protocols to maximize returns, often through providing liquidity to decentralized exchanges. The appeal of DeFi lies in its ability to offer interest rates that can significantly outperform traditional savings accounts, all managed through smart contracts, thereby reducing counterparty risk.

The concept of "earning while you hold" is a powerful attractor, and the Blockchain Profit System champions this through various mechanisms. Beyond staking and yield farming, there are lending protocols where you can lend your crypto assets to borrowers and earn interest. These platforms operate autonomously, governed by smart contracts that manage collateral and interest rates. This is a testament to the system’s ability to automate and decentralize financial services, making them more accessible and potentially more lucrative for the individual investor.

Another fascinating area is within the realm of blockchain-based gaming and the metaverse. Play-to-earn (P2E) games allow players to earn cryptocurrency or NFTs by participating in the game. These assets can then be traded on marketplaces, creating a direct link between time invested and financial reward. Similarly, virtual land and assets within metaverse platforms, which are often built on blockchain, can be bought, sold, and developed, offering speculative and utility-based profit opportunities. The Blockchain Profit System recognizes these emergent digital economies as legitimate avenues for wealth creation.

For those with a more entrepreneurial spirit, the Blockchain Profit System provides tools for launching new ventures. Initial Coin Offerings (ICOs), Security Token Offerings (STOs), and Decentralized Autonomous Organization (DAO) governance tokens offer ways to raise capital and build communities around new projects. Participating in these as an early investor, or even contributing to their development, can yield substantial returns if the project succeeds. DAOs, in particular, represent a novel form of organization where token holders collectively make decisions, aligning incentives and fostering a sense of shared ownership and profit.

The underlying infrastructure of the Blockchain Profit System is constantly evolving, with new innovations emerging regularly. Layer-2 scaling solutions are improving transaction speeds and reducing costs, making blockchain applications more practical for everyday use. Cross-chain interoperability solutions are enabling seamless asset transfers between different blockchains, expanding the potential for arbitrage and diversified investment strategies. The development of more user-friendly interfaces and wallets is also crucial for onboarding a wider audience into this sophisticated financial ecosystem.

However, it's imperative to approach the Blockchain Profit System with a clear understanding of the risks involved. Volatility is a significant factor in cryptocurrency markets, and DeFi protocols, while innovative, can be susceptible to smart contract bugs, exploits, and impermanent loss. Regulatory landscapes are also still developing, adding another layer of uncertainty. Therefore, education, due diligence, and a risk-management strategy are not just advisable; they are fundamental to succeeding within this system.

At its core, cryptocurrency is built upon a revolutionary technology called blockchain. Think of blockchain as a distributed, immutable ledger that records every transaction across a network of computers. This decentralization is key. Unlike traditional financial systems controlled by central authorities like banks or governments, blockchain operates on consensus, making it transparent, secure, and resistant to censorship or manipulation. Understanding this foundational technology is the first step towards comprehending the value proposition of crypto. Bitcoin, the pioneer, demonstrated the power of a decentralized, peer-to-peer digital currency. Ethereum, on the other hand, expanded this concept by introducing smart contracts – self-executing contracts with the terms of the agreement directly written into code. This innovation paved the way for decentralized applications (dApps) and the burgeoning world of Decentralized Finance (DeFi).

For those new to the space, the sheer number of cryptocurrencies can be overwhelming. While Bitcoin and Ethereum remain dominant forces, often referred to as "blue-chip" cryptos due to their established market cap and widespread adoption, the universe of altcoins (alternative coins) is vast and dynamic. Each altcoin aims to solve a specific problem or offer a unique utility, ranging from facilitating faster transactions (e.g., Litecoin) to enabling decentralized internet infrastructure (e.g., Filecoin) or powering gaming ecosystems (e.g., Axie Infinity). Navigating this diverse landscape requires diligent research and a clear investment thesis. Not all altcoins are created equal, and separating the genuine innovations from speculative gambits is crucial.

One of the most fundamental crypto wealth strategies is long-term holding, often termed "HODLing." This strategy, born from a typo in a Bitcoin forum post in 2013, has proven remarkably effective for many early adopters. The philosophy is simple: buy promising cryptocurrencies, typically Bitcoin or Ethereum, and hold them through market cycles, believing in their long-term value appreciation. This approach requires patience and an ironclad conviction in the underlying technology and its potential to disrupt traditional industries. The advantage of HODLing is its simplicity and the potential for significant gains as the market matures. However, it also means weathering significant volatility. A successful HODLer needs a strong emotional constitution, the ability to resist panic selling during market downturns, and a thorough understanding of the assets they are holding. Diversification within this strategy is also key – rather than putting all your eggs in one digital basket, spreading your investments across a few well-researched, fundamentally sound projects can mitigate risk.

Beyond simple holding, active trading presents another avenue for crypto wealth. This involves buying and selling cryptocurrencies based on short-term price movements, often employing technical analysis to identify patterns and predict future trends. Day trading, swing trading, and scalping are common trading styles, each with its own risk-reward profile. Active trading can be lucrative, but it demands a significant time commitment, a deep understanding of market dynamics, and a high tolerance for risk. The emotional toll of constant monitoring and rapid decision-making can be substantial. For beginners, it is often recommended to start with smaller amounts and gain experience before committing substantial capital to active trading. Educational resources and practice trading platforms can be invaluable tools in developing the necessary skills.

A more modern and increasingly popular wealth-building strategy in the crypto space is leveraging Decentralized Finance (DeFi). DeFi aims to replicate traditional financial services – lending, borrowing, trading, insurance – on open, permissionless blockchain networks. Platforms like Aave, Compound, and Uniswap allow users to earn interest on their crypto holdings through lending, stake their assets to provide liquidity and earn transaction fees, or participate in yield farming. These strategies can offer attractive annual percentage yields (APYs), often far exceeding those available in traditional finance. However, DeFi also comes with its own set of risks. Smart contract vulnerabilities, impermanent loss (a risk when providing liquidity), and the inherent volatility of the underlying crypto assets are factors that must be carefully considered. Thorough due diligence on the platform and the associated risks is paramount before diving into DeFi opportunities. Understanding the mechanics of each protocol and the potential downsides is essential for preserving capital while seeking to grow it. The composability of DeFi, where different protocols can interact with each other, creates exciting opportunities but also introduces complex interdependencies that can amplify risks.

One of the most compelling ways to generate passive income within the crypto ecosystem is through staking. Staking is the process of actively participating in the operation of a Proof-of-Stake (PoS) blockchain network. By holding and "locking up" a certain amount of a cryptocurrency, you contribute to the network's security and transaction validation. In return for your contribution, you are rewarded with more of that cryptocurrency, effectively earning interest on your holdings. Popular PoS cryptocurrencies like Cardano (ADA), Solana (SOL), and Polkadot (DOT) offer attractive staking yields. The ease of participation varies; some networks allow direct staking through native wallets, while others can be accessed through exchanges or staking pools. Staking offers a relatively stable way to grow your crypto portfolio passively, provided the underlying cryptocurrency maintains its value. However, it’s crucial to understand the lock-up periods, as your staked assets may not be immediately accessible. Furthermore, the value of your rewards is directly tied to the price performance of the staked asset. If the price plummets, your staking rewards, while earned, might not offset the capital loss.

Another significant avenue for passive income generation is lending. In the DeFi space, you can lend your cryptocurrencies to borrowers and earn interest on the loan. Platforms like Aave, Compound, and MakerDAO facilitate this process. These decentralized lending protocols pool user deposits and allow others to borrow assets, with interest rates often determined by supply and demand. The yields can be quite competitive, especially for less common or more volatile assets. However, lending in DeFi carries its own set of risks. Smart contract bugs, platform hacks, or the liquidation of collateral can lead to loss of funds. It’s imperative to research the security audits of any lending platform and understand the collateralization ratios and liquidation mechanisms. Similarly, traditional centralized exchanges (CEXs) also offer lending programs, often with simpler interfaces but with counterparty risk – meaning you are trusting the exchange to manage your funds securely.

For those with a more entrepreneurial spirit or a keen understanding of specific crypto projects, yield farming, also known as liquidity mining, can offer even higher potential returns, albeit with significantly greater risk. Yield farming involves providing liquidity to decentralized exchanges (DEXs) or lending protocols. Liquidity providers (LPs) deposit pairs of cryptocurrencies into a pool, enabling others to trade between those assets. In return, LPs earn a portion of the trading fees generated by the pool, and often receive additional rewards in the form of the protocol's native token. The allure of yield farming lies in the potential for high APYs, often amplified by incentives from newly launched projects. However, this strategy is fraught with complexities. Impermanent loss, where the value of your deposited assets diverges from simply holding them, is a constant concern. Furthermore, the volatile nature of crypto, combined with the potential for rug pulls (where project developers abandon a project and abscond with investor funds), makes yield farming a high-risk, high-reward endeavor. It requires a deep understanding of tokenomics, smart contract risks, and market sentiment.

Beyond passive income, robust risk management is the bedrock of any sustainable wealth strategy, especially in the volatile crypto market. Diversification, as mentioned earlier, is paramount. This means not only spreading investments across different cryptocurrencies but also across different sectors within the crypto space – Bitcoin, Ethereum, DeFi tokens, NFTs, gaming tokens, and so on. However, it's important to remember that during significant market downturns, correlations between crypto assets can increase, meaning diversification may not fully protect against losses. A well-defined risk tolerance is crucial. Before investing, one should determine how much capital they are willing to risk and how much volatility they can stomach. This personal assessment will guide investment decisions and prevent emotional responses to market fluctuations.

Implementing a dollar-cost averaging (DCA) strategy can be highly effective for mitigating the impact of volatility. DCA involves investing a fixed amount of money at regular intervals, regardless of the price. This approach helps average out your purchase price over time, reducing the risk of buying in at a market peak. It’s a patient strategy that benefits from consistent execution and is particularly well-suited for long-term investors.

Furthermore, understanding exit strategies is as important as entry strategies. Having a plan for when to take profits or cut losses can save significant capital. This might involve setting predetermined price targets or stop-loss orders. Emotional discipline is key here; resist the urge to chase every rally or to hold on too long when a trend reverses.

The regulatory landscape surrounding cryptocurrency is also constantly evolving. Staying informed about potential regulations, tax implications, and compliance requirements in your jurisdiction is a critical aspect of responsible crypto wealth management. Ignoring these aspects can lead to unforeseen legal or financial complications.

Finally, security is non-negotiable. Protecting your digital assets from hackers and scams is paramount. Employing strong, unique passwords, enabling two-factor authentication (2FA) on all your accounts, and using hardware wallets for storing significant amounts of cryptocurrency are essential security practices. Be wary of phishing attempts and unsolicited offers that seem too good to be true.
